Multiple myeloma-derived exosomes are enriched of amphiregulin (AREG) and activate the epidermal growth factor pathway in the bone microenvironment leading to osteoclastogenesis

Abstract Background Multiple myeloma (MM) is a clonal plasma cell malignancy associated with osteolytic bone disease.
